How much does fence installation cost?

Residential fence installation costs $10 to $30 per linear foot on average, with most homes and backyards needing 150' of fence. Fencing prices for a wood privacy fence, vinyl fence, or chain-link fence are $1,500 to $4,000 installed. Additional costs may apply for custom fences, existing fence removal, a land survey, and permits.

If you've already purchased the materials, fencing companies charge $50 to $70 per hour on average.

What questions to ask when hiring a local fence installer?

The best fence companies are licensed, bonded, insured, and happy to answer questions about their business. Before hiring, ask the following questions:

  • Do you offer free estimates?
  • How much will my project cost? Can I get a written estimate?
  • Are the gates part of the quote?
  • Are you licensed?
  • Is your work insured or bonded?
  • How long have you been in business?
  • Do you offer a warranty or guarantee?
  • Will you be performing the work or someone else?
  • Will you pull the permits?
  • Will you call the utility company to help locate underground utility lines?
  • How long will my project take, and when can you start?
  • What payment methods do you accept, and what is your payment schedule? Do you offer financing?

After asking questions and verifying their credentials, hire the most reasonable and affordable fence installer near you.

What are the best types of fences to install?

The best types of fences are wood and vinyl because they offer backyard privacy. Metal, aluminum, and chain-link fencing serves as a property dividing line and provides security, but is not visually appealing and does not provide privacy. Security or wrought iron fencing is solid, durable, and can last a lifetime, but is expensive.

Do fences increase property value?

Installing a backyard fence increases the home property value, has a 50% return on investment, and can provide privacy. A front-yard fence may reduce the curb appeal of your home, unless it's common in the neighborhood or blocks highway noise.

Does home insurance cover fences?

Homeowners insurance covers damage or replacement of your fence from unexpected events such as being blown over in wind storms, lightning, hail, vehicle damage, vandalism, fallen trees, or fire and smoke.

Can I install my own fence?

Installing a fence yourself saves 50% of the total cost, but may take two full weeks of labor. Fencing materials alone cost $8 to $15 per linear foot, plus $200 to $500 for renting or buying equipment such as a drill, hammer, saw, auger, post hole digger, and measuring tape.

A professional fence contractor knows local building codes, pulls permits, flags underground utility lines, provides a warranty, and only takes 2 to 4 days to install a new fence.
